Tax Judge Highlights New Tripartite Model for Digital Economy
Tax Court Judge Junaidi Eko Widodo speaking in JakartaGambar: news.ddtc.co.id

Jakarta, 7 November 2025 – Tax Court Judge Junaidi Eko Widodo said the rise of the digital economy will create a tripartite tax relationship, adding marketplaces as a third party alongside taxpayers and the fiscal authority. This model differs from the traditional two‑party framework.

Under Indonesian tax law, the relationship has historically been between the taxpayer and the tax authority. The Tax Procedures Law (Law No. 28/2007) introduces a third actor, the Electronic System Marketplace Operator (PPMSE), appointed to collect, remit and report tax.

If affirmed, marketplaces would acquire taxpayer status with comparable rights and duties, including audit and objection rights. This could increase administrative burdens for e‑commerce operators while expanding the digital tax base. Regulators are expected to issue detailed rules to provide legal certainty.
